ASoC: soc-dai: don't overwide dai->driver->ops
authorKuninori Morimoto <kuninori.morimoto.gx@renesas.com>
Thu, 23 Apr 2020 23:14:43 +0000 (08:14 +0900)
committerMark Brown <broonie@kernel.org>
Wed, 29 Apr 2020 12:27:35 +0000 (13:27 +0100)
Current ASoC overwrites null_dai_ops to dai->driver->ops if it
was NULL. But, we can remove it if framework always checks
dai->driver->ops when it uses DAI callbacks.
This patch do it, and removes null_dai_ops.
